Coronavirus: 35 of 74 close contacts traced following first Malaysian case
The Borneo Post - News·2020-02-06 00:09
PUTRAJAYA: Seventy-four people have been identified for contact tracing following the first Malaysian case of the 2019 novel coronavirus (2019-nCoV), said Health Minister Datuk Seri Dr Dzulkefly Ahmad.
He said out of the 74 close contacts identified, 35 were traced and samples taken from them.
